A valuable diamond called the Moonstone is stolen from a young woman. A detective and the woman's cousin try to find the thief and recover the gem.

The Moonstone is a 1915 silent film directed by Frank Hall Crane. The film stars Eugene O'Brien as Franklin Blake, Elaine Hammerstein as Rachel Verinder, Ruth Findlay as Rosanna Spearman, among others. A copy of this film survives.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
